标题:剖析关系型数据库的结构类型
一、引言
在当今数字化时代,数据已成为企业和组织的重要资产,而关系型数据库作为一种广泛应用的数据存储和管理技术,其结构类型对于理解和运用它至关重要,本文将深入探讨关系型数据库的结构类型,帮助读者更好地掌握这一关键技术。
二、关系型数据库的基本概念
关系型数据库是基于关系模型建立的数据库系统,它通过表格的形式来组织数据,每个表格都有特定的名称和列,这些表格之间通过关联关系相互连接,从而实现数据的完整性和一致性。
三、关系型数据库的结构类型
1、表结构:表是关系型数据库中最基本的结构单元,它由行和列组成,每行代表一个记录,每列代表一个属性,表结构的定义包括列名、数据类型、约束条件等。
2、主键:主键是表中的一个或多个列,用于唯一标识表中的每一行记录,主键的值不能重复,也不能为 NULL。
3、外键:外键是用于建立表之间关联关系的列,它引用了其他表中的主键,确保数据的一致性和完整性。
4、关系:关系是表之间的关联,通过外键实现,常见的关系类型包括一对一、一对多和多对多。
5、索引:索引是用于提高数据库查询性能的一种结构,它可以加快数据的检索速度,但也会占用一定的存储空间。
四、关系型数据库的优点
1、数据一致性和完整性:通过主键和外键的约束,关系型数据库能够确保数据的一致性和完整性,避免数据冗余和不一致性。
2、灵活的查询语言:关系型数据库通常提供了强大的查询语言,如 SQL,使得用户能够方便地进行数据查询、更新和删除等操作。
3、良好的性能:通过合理的索引设计和优化,关系型数据库能够提供良好的性能,满足企业级应用的需求。
4、易于理解和使用:关系型数据库的结构和概念相对简单,易于理解和使用,适合各种层次的用户。
五、关系型数据库的局限性
1、数据存储容量有限:关系型数据库在处理大规模数据时,可能会受到存储容量的限制。
2、复杂查询性能问题:在处理复杂查询时,关系型数据库可能会出现性能问题,特别是在数据量较大的情况下。
3、不适合非结构化数据:关系型数据库主要用于存储结构化数据,对于非结构化数据的处理能力有限。
六、结论
关系型数据库作为一种重要的数据存储和管理技术,其结构类型对于理解和运用它至关重要,通过了解关系型数据库的基本概念、结构类型和优点,我们可以更好地掌握这一技术,并在实际应用中发挥其优势,我们也应该认识到关系型数据库的局限性,并在需要时考虑其他数据存储和管理技术,以满足不同的应用需求。
评论列表